Cultural and literary studies explore the complex relationships between literature, culture and society. This diverse field examines how literature reflects and shapes cultural identities, values and social norms. It explores various genres, historical contexts and cultural movements, analyzing texts to understand broader societal issues like race, gender, class and power dynamics. Cultural and literary studies also consider the role of media, film and other cultural artifacts in influencing public perception and cultural discourse. By integrating theories from anthropology, sociology and philosophy, this field provides a comprehensive understanding of how cultural products impact and are impacted by the world around them. It encourages critical thinking and a deeper appreciation of the diverse ways in which culture and literature intersect and interact.
